Unix & Linux

35
Jak odczytać cały skrypt powłoki przed jego uruchomieniem?

Zwykle po edycji skryptu wszystkie uruchomione skrypty są podatne na błędy. O ile rozumiem, bash (także inne powłoki?) Stopniowo odczytuje skrypt, więc jeśli zmodyfikowałeś plik skryptu zewnętrznie, zaczyna on odczytywać niewłaściwe rzeczy. Czy jest jakiś sposób, aby temu...

35
Jak mogę spowolnić rsync?

Próbuję skopiować zawartość uszkodzonego napędu USB. Jeśli odczytam dane zbyt szybko, układ kontrolera napędu przegrzewa się, a dysk znika z systemu. Kiedy tak się stanie, muszę odłączyć dysk, odczekać minutę, aż ostygnie, podłączyć go z powrotem i ponownie uruchomić kopię. Mam starą kopię...

35
Która strona podręcznika opisuje proces włączania komputera?

Kilka lat temu przypominam sobie korzystanie z terminala i czytanie samouczka w podręczniku systemu Linux (za pomocą man) na temat działania komputera po jego włączeniu. Przeprowadził cię przez cały proces wyjaśniając rolę BIOS, ROM, RAM i systemu operacyjnego w tym procesie. Która to była strona,...

35
Różnica między [0–9], [[: cyfra:]] i \ d

W artykule Wikipedii na temat wyrażeń regularnych wydaje się, że [[:digit:]]= [0-9]= \d. W jakich okolicznościach nie są one równe? Jaka jest różnica? Po niektórych badaniach wydaje mi się, że jedną różnicą jest to, że wyrażenie w [:expr:]nawiasach zależy od ustawień...

34
Jaka jest architektura systemu okien Mac OS X?

Wiem, jak działa system X11, w którym klienci łączą się za pośrednictwem gniazda z procesem serwera i wysyłają operacje do serwera okien w celu wykonania pewnych operacji w ich imieniu. Ale nie rozumiem (i nie mogłem znaleźć dobrych dokumentów) opisujących interakcję aplikacji GUI z systemem okien...

34
Otwórz plik podany w wyniku polecenia w vimie

Prawie codziennie robię następujące rzeczy Uruchom wyszukiwanie ( find -name somefile.txt) Otwórz wynik w vim Problem polega na tym, że muszę skopiować i wkleić wynik polecenia finddo vimpolecenia. Czy jest jakiś sposób na uniknięcie tego? Trochę eksperymentowałem ( find -name somefile.txt |...

34
Vim - Pobierz bieżący katalog

Obecnie dodaję trochę funkcji Git do mojego pliku menu.vim, a do korzystania z określonego polecenia (Gitk) muszę znaleźć bieżący katalog Vima. Jak to zrobić i uwzględnić w poleceniu? (tj. :!echo "%current-directory") Przyznaję, że zadałem złe pytanie - ale wymyśliłem to. Obecnie używam ich w...